Our client’s flexible legal services platform provides businesses with fast access to a pool of high-quality consultants to meet their flexible resourcing needs. The Senior Client Manager will lead the UK client engagement and sales activities to strengthen market positioning, increase profitability, and ensure exceptional service delivery. This role will work closely with cross-functional teams to drive global client strategies and maintain long-term relationships, contributing to sustainable growth.
The Responsibilities:
Collaborate with the leadership team to develop and implement a comprehensive client engagement strategy, aligning with overall growth and market expansion goals.
Foster and deepen relationships with key clients, ensuring consistent and effective communication across all touchpoints.
Work alongside various business functions to cross-sell flexible resourcing solutions and enhance internal collaborations.
Lead and manage the UK sales team, driving the promotion and sale of flexible legal services to clients while maintaining smooth service delivery across multiple practices.
Work with the leadership team to set and achieve ambitious sales targets, ensuring the generation of sustainable revenue and growth.
Act as the primary escalation point for all client-related matters within the UK, resolving complex and strategic issues.
Oversee client-facing activities, including the development and delivery of thought leadership content, event programming, pitches and relationship management strategies.
Develop and implement pricing strategies for the UK market, aligning with industry trends to maximise profitability and support growth.
Lead, mentor, and inspire a high-performing team, setting clear goals and fostering a culture of collaboration and excellence.
Support the UK sales team with high-priority sales opportunities and provide hands-on assistance during peak periods or staff absences.
The Candidate:
Extensive experience managing client relationships and driving sales within a professional services environment, preferably within the legal sector or related industries.
Demonstrated experience in a senior role within a flexible legal services platform, legal recruitment, or alternative legal services.
Proven track record in driving client engagement strategies, relationship management, and revenue growth.
Experience leading high-performing teams, fostering collaboration, and managing strategic initiatives to achieve business growth.
Strong commercial acumen, with a demonstrated ability to develop and execute pricing strategies and manage market dynamics.
Strong problem-solving skills, able to identify and address challenges while maintaining focus on team and client objectives.
